Summary:Speaking at the Edinburgh International TV Festival, president Kent Alterman said his team has been spending time with Comedy Central UK in an effort to unite the Viacom-owned brand internationally. The exec, who joined Comedy Central in 2010, cited Viacom boss Bob Bakish’s five-point plan to put the entertainment giant’s “full power” behind flagship brands BET, Comedy Central, MTV, Nickelodeon, Nick Jr. and Paramount.
